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ma cases require years of experience and specialized knowledge. A mesothelioma lawyer with experience will have a variety of resources to help victims obtain compensation.

As mesothelioma has a lengthy latency period, it could take years for symptoms to appear. A mesothelioma law firm will review medical records, look into the background of employees, and gather evidence to build a strong case.

Real Estate Litigation

Asbestos is a fibrous mineral that has many industrial uses and was utilized in building and construction materials for many years because it is fire resistant, flexible, and has a high tensile strength. Unfortunately, asbestos is also toxic and causes many types of mesothelioma-related diseases, including lung cancer and pleural mesothelioma, which are usually fatal. Asbestos victims require legal representation to pursue financial compensation for their medical expenses, funeral costs as well as lost income and other losses.

The most experienced mesothelioma lawyers have specialized knowledge of asbestos case [my sources] litigation and are able to assist clients in understanding their rights. This type of lawyer works on a contingent fee basis. This means that fees of the attorney are contingent on the outcome of a settlement or verdict that is favorable for their client. Lawyers can charge for research, drafting legal documents, conducting and defending depositions, preparing and conducting trials, and other case-related tasks.

It is essential to find a lawyer as quickly as you can following an mesothelioma diagnosis or the death of a close friend due to an asbestos-related disease. The statute of limitation is only a short period of time to file a lawsuit. This limit is usually determined by the date that the diagnosis was made in personal injury cases and the date of death for wrongful death claims.

A national company that specializes in asbestos litigation usually has access to crucial information and databases which can assist patients in determining the date, time and how they were exposed to asbestos. This information is vital in seeking compensation from asbestos manufacturers responsible for victims' health issues.

A trustworthy mesothelioma lawyer can provide victims with information about possible asbestos trust funds through which they could receive financial compensation. Several asbestos companies declared bankruptcy, and although the majority of them can't be sued, their assets may be used by victims to receive compensation. Asbestos victims and their families can receive millions of dollars through settlements and verdicts. The national mesothelioma firms at Simmons Hanly Conroy have a track record of obtaining large settlements and verdicts in asbestos-related injuries.

Workers Compensation Claims

People who have been diagnosed with an asbestos-related disease like mesothelioma or lung cancer could be eligible for financial compensation. The compensation from a lawsuit can be used to pay medical bills, lost wages, home care expenses, funeral and burial costs in the case of the death of a victim, and many more. Attorneys who specialize in asbestos litigation can assist families of victims seek compensation against those who are responsible for the exposure.

The lawyers at Weitz & Luxembourg are experts in asbestos-related personal injury and workers' compensation cases. They represent railroad workers, shipyard workers, construction workers, automobile workers, and veterans of the United States Armed Forces. Many of them suffered exposure to asbestos at work and then brought the dangerous material home with them which exposed their families.

Attorneys can aid victims in filing claims for disability benefits through the Occupational Safety and Health Administration. Those who suffer from mesothelioma or any other asbestos-related diseases that are related to work are eligible to receive compensation under the workers' compensation system. In order to obtain this aid, the injured person must prove that he or she was exposed to asbestos while working and that this exposure caused his or her disease.

People who have been diagnosed with an asbestos-related disease should consult a lawyer as soon as they can. Mesothelioma can be a fatal cancer, however it can be difficult to recognize. It usually develops years after exposure. An experienced attorney can help the victim and family members collect evidence, including medical records and employment histories to file an effective claim for compensation.

The time-limit for most personal injury cases is three years, but this can be extended in mesothelioma cases and other asbestos-related illnesses claims. Mesothelioma symptoms can develop over time and those affected could have worked or lived in many different places across the globe. It is essential to ensure that anyone who believes they might be entitled to compensation, immediately seek out an attorney to assess their claim.

Personal Injury Claims

Asbestos exposure is known to cause a variety of serious illnesses. These include mesothelioma (a cancerous tumor that attacks the lung linings or stomach). Asbestosis is a painful respiratory condition that can be quite disfiguring. Patients suffering from mesothelioma or other asbestos-related illnesses have a legal right to claim compensation for past, present and future medical expenses and lost income, as well as suffering and punitive damages in some jurisdictions.

A New York asbestos attorney can help victims and their families get the compensation they deserve. A law firm that deals with asbestos cases on a nationwide basis could be able to get more compensation than a single state law firm due to its connections and resources.

The Lanier Law Firm is a firm of lawyers who specialize in holding corporations accountable for exposing people to asbestos in a negligent manner. Asbestos is a mineral that occurs naturally, was prized due to its flame-resisting properties during the 20th Century. It was used for everything from shipbuilding to automobile brakes. The Lanier Law Firm has helped those suffering from mesothelioma as well as other asbestos lawyer-related diseases receive compensation for their losses.

In the United States, asbestos has been found in many jobs. The most vulnerable to exposure are those who worked on ships, in the construction industry, in powerhouses, as well as in the automobile industry. Certain veterans of the military may have been exposed asbestos while serving in the Navy or the Army. An experienced lawyer can help veterans obtain VA benefits for disabilities and free medical treatment.
